Credit Suisse Predicts Renewable Energy That Is “Too Cheap To Meter” By 2025

CleanTechnica EVs

Credit Suisse says the Inflation Reduction Act will have such a tremendous impact on renewable energy that the US may see the levelized cost of electricity from renewable sources fall to less than 1 cent per kWh hour by 2025 after factoring in all tax and production credits. Proposed California Bill SB-233 Mandates Bidirectional Charging for EVs to Advance Grid and Climate Protection

Driivz

The ultimate promise: vehicle-to-grid Many see V2G, where the EV receives power from the grid when it is cheap or plentiful and gives power back to the grid to balance and supplement the grid as needed, as the ultimate game changer. SB-233 covers school buses as well so they can power V2B and fleet depots use cases.
